Understanding Circle Basics
To start with, it’s essential to understand the basic components of a circle, including the center, radius, diameter, and circumference. The center of a circle is the point that is equidistant from every point on the circle. The radius is the distance from the center to any point on the circle, while the diameter is the distance across the circle, passing through its center. The circumference is the distance around the circle. Mastering these concepts is vital for solving problems related to circles.
